Hosted by Guru Anand Bodhi, this series reveals how our inner ecosystems mirror the living world around us, connecting personal health to planetary well-being. Each episode explores the surprising science linking biodiversity, mental clarity, and contemplative practice to ecological flourishing and human resilience.

  • Biome - Green Spaces, Open Hearts: Why Biodiversity Heals the Mind
    Apr 9 2026
    Join Guru Anand Bodhi as he explores how urban biodiversity directly impacts mental health, drawing on Sheffield park studies and pandemic-era research. Discover why species-rich green spaces offer cognitive restoration, emotional resilience, and a profound sense of belonging—backed by ecological science and integral health frameworks that connect human flourishing to environmental diversity.
